confluent2xcat(8) -- Export confluent nodes to an xCAT stanza definition ======================================================================== ## SYNOPSIS `confluent2xcat -o ` [`-m `] ## DESCRIPTION `confluent2xcat` reads the nodes matched by `` from confluent and writes an xCAT object definition stanza file, easing interoperation with or migration to/from an xCAT environment. Optionally it can also write an xCAT `macs.csv` file capturing the MAC addresses of the nodes. ## OPTIONS * `-o FILE`, `--output=FILE`: Write the xCAT stanza definition to FILE. * `-m FILE`, `--macs=FILE`: Write an xCAT macs.csv file to FILE. * `-h`, `--help`: Show help message and exit ## EXAMPLES * Export all nodes to an xCAT stanza file: `# confluent2xcat everything -o xcatnodes.def` * Also capture MAC addresses: `# confluent2xcat everything -o xcatnodes.def -m macs.csv` ## SEE ALSO confluent2ansible(8), confluent2lxca(8), nodelist(8)
